Overview
- Speaking at APEC in Gyeongju, Carney said he apologized to Trump and indicated talks would resume when Washington is ready.
- Trump kept a 10% tariff increase in place and declined to restart formal negotiations after a cordial exchange he described with Carney.
- The ad was produced by Ontario and used Reagan’s remarks on tariffs, which Trump labeled misrepresented and wrong.
- Trump said he maintains a good personal relationship with Carney despite refusing to lift the suspension of trade talks.
- Most U.S.–Canada trade remains tariff‑free under USMCA, though sectoral surtaxes and the new hike have added pressure on Ottawa.
